How they compare
Taiwan currently reports 116.36 against 107.35 in Japan, a difference of 9.01.
That makes Taiwan's figure about 1.1 times Japan's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 40 shared years of data; in 1987 it was Japan ahead.
Japan ranks 70th and Taiwan ranks 68th of 71 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Japan averaged higher in 3 and Taiwan in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Japan | Taiwan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 90.88 | 70.48 | 20.4 | Japan |
| 1990s | 102 | 88.49 | 13.51 | Japan |
| 2000s | 102.71 | 98.48 | 4.23 | Japan |
| 2010s | 99.91 | 103.1 | 3.18 | Taiwan |
| 2020s | 103.67 | 111.17 | 7.5 | Taiwan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
